Abstract
"César Ortiz Anderson es el Presidente de la Asociación Pro Seguridad Ciudadana – APROSEC, una institución que ha trabajado muchísimo en los últimos nueve años, preocupada por el clima de inseguridad ciudadana que viven las ciudades de todo el Perú" ["César Ortiz Anderson is the President of the Association for Public Safety - APROSEC, an institution that has worked hard in the last nine years, concerned about the climate of insecurity living cities around the Peru"]
